As we age, the quality of the skin changes. This has to do with the biological clock but also with lifestyle factors such as sun exposure. Collagen and elastic fibers are degraded, and the quality of the body's own hyaluronic acid is reduced. This results in decreased elasticity, increased roughness and dryness of the skin.
While creams pamper your skin on the surface, Restylane Vital™ will take care of your skin from within. A Restylane Vital treatment involves the injection of small amounts of stabilized hyaluronic acid into the skin, this restores the hydrobalance and improves the skin’s structure.
Research at the University of Hamburg, Germany, has shown that Restylane Vital reduces several signs of skin aging. The elasticity of the skin is significantly improved and the roughness is decreased. The improvements are measurable as well as visible to the eye. All women in the study reported that their expectations were met and 85% of them rated Restylane Vital as “very good” or “good”. For a successful result it is important to use a stabilized hyaluronic acid to ensure a long-lasting effect.

Unlike many skin rejuvenation products, Restylane Vital is free of additives and is produced from a non-animal source. This results in a safe and natural treatment. Restylane products have been safely used in 10 million treatments worldwide.

Restylane® is a Prescription Medicine for the treatment of facial tissue augmentation.  Its use is recommended in the correction of wrinkles and lip enhancement.

Do not inject this medicine intravascularly as there is a potential risk of rarely leading to vascular occlusion with transient impairment of vision, transient ischaemia or even necrosis.  Do not use in patients with bleeding disorder or patients who have undergone therapy with thrombolytics, anticoagulants, or inhibitors of platelet aggregation in the preceding 2 weeks.

Like any such procedure, the implantation of Restylane® is associated with an inherent risk of infection. Restylane® should not be used in or near anatomic sites where there is active skin disease, inflammation or related conditions.

Patients using substances that may affect platelet function, such as aspirin and NSAIDs, may experience increased bruising or bleeding at injection sites.

Restylane should not be injected into an area where a permanent implant has been placed. The patient should not be exposed to extreme heat or cold until the initial swelling and redness have resolved. It should not be used in pregnant or breastfeeding women or in children.

Common injection-related side effects such as erythema, swelling, pain, itching or tenderness at the implant site may occur.  Resolution of these effects is normally spontaneous from a few days after injection into the skin to a week after injection into the lips. Additional, temporary palpable lumpiness has also been noted in some patients.

Other rare side effects such as biopsy proven granuloma formulation, necrosis or persistent discolouration have occurred. There have also been isolated cases of oedema and urticaria reported.

Administration of Restylane should be as per the detailed instructions on the datasheet for the various formulations.

Note: After the first treatment, additional implantations of Restylane may be necessary to achieve the desired level of correction.  Times may vary from 6 months to a year.
